FIELD: ophthalmologic surgery.
SUBSTANCE: artificial crystalline lens with weighed intraocular change in focal power corresponding to changes in refraction has optical and haptic parts. Crystalline lens is made of parts for intraocular weighed change in focal power corresponding to changes in refraction due to fact that haptic part is made in form of open round arc. One side of arc is made for movement to center of circle. Both sides of arc are provided with arc-shaped pockets turned with their open parts inside arc. Shape of pockets is congruent to shape of external surface of arc for interaction with optical part. External surfaces of round arc are provided with arc-shaped support members directed to opposite sides.
EFFECT: reduced traumatism of weighed intraocular correction of myopia, hypermetropia, anisometropia and induced ametropia.
